If you download the v2.2 English translation, you might find that not every button or label is in English. Some language elements—like "BIEN" (Good), "Cerrar" (Close), or "Archivo" (File)—remain in Spanish because they are hardcoded into the executable. This does not affect functionality; it simply requires remembering that "Archivo" means File and "Crear juego desde ISO" means Create Game from ISO.

Functionally, USBUtil 2.0 offered several features critical to the PS2 homebrew workflow. It could detect and parse BIN/CUE and ISO images, compress or convert images into more loader-friendly formats (such as converting to a stripped or compressed ISO), and generate the correct naming schemes using game IDs. It supported exporting game images directly to USB drives or to a hard disk in a layout compatible with popular loaders. For users seeking to run homebrew applications rather than retail backups, USBUtil also helped package ELF and other executable formats into folders that launchers like uLaunchELF could navigate. Together with file managers and loaders on the PS2 side, USBUtil formed a bridge between raw disc images on a PC and playable content on vintage console hardware.
